Ten Years in North Korea
There are few countries in the world that remain so closed that almost no one from outside gains insight. North Korea is certainly one of the most secluded. The dictatorship, which has been ruled by the same family for generations, prohibits almost all contact beyond its borders, isolating 26 million inhabitants from the rest of humanity. This is why Xiomara Bender's photo book "Waiting for the Rainbow" is so valuable, as it deals with the Korean region in a very honest way.
The author portrays the lives and daily routines of the people in this country, which few get the chance to know. She wants to draw attention to the many destinies and the changes of recent years, which in this strict dictatorship are only possible in subtle micro-steps. Through her photographic journey through time, her readers can witness this transformation that brings hope. People who appear more self-assured as the book progresses, a smile that turns into laughter, clothing that gradually reflects more fashion than uniformity. All of this is shown to us by the author in emotionally resonant images.
Over almost ten years, Bender undertook nine trips to North Korea to bring back this unique photo documentation. The award-winning artist wants to break through the culture of deliberate ignorance about North Korea with her work and, without reproach, draw attention to the unvarnished daily lives of the people who live there and their state-orchestrated routines.
In addition to the moving images, the author encourages reflection through many short texts, without coming across as didactic. Her language is art, which opens up to those who pave the way.

Elliott Erwitt’s Kolor – New Edition
Author: Elliott ErwittElliott Erwitt’s Kolor – New Edition is an impressive coffee table book that brings together more than seventy years of photography in sparkling, surprisingly fresh colors. This new edition presents a carefully curated selection of color photographs by one of the most influential photographers of the 20th and 21st centuries.
The images come from Erwitt's immense archive of almost half a million Kodachrome slides. Spread across 304 pages, a visual journey unfolds, full of humor, humanity, and keen observation. From world leaders to showgirls, from vibrant markets to military camps, and from Las Vegas to Venice: each image carries Elliott Erwitt's characteristic dry wit and subtle sensibility.
What makes this publication special is the exceptional quality of the colors. Some photos are more than seventy years old, yet they still look intense and vibrant. They bring historical moments and everyday scenes to life in a way that feels timeless. Kolor is therefore not only a visual spectacle but also a valuable document of modern history.
This coffee table book is a must-have for lovers of photography, art, design, and visual culture, and a beautiful statement piece for any bookshelf or coffee table.

About the author – Elliott ErwittElliott Erwitt was born in Paris in 1928 and grew up in Milan, Paris, New York, and Los Angeles, among other places. In these cities, he developed his love for photography, which would grow into a career of unprecedented influence. As a Magnum photographer, Erwitt gained worldwide fame with his visual essays, iconic magazine assignments, and personal work.
His photography is renowned for its combination of keen observation, humanity, and subtle humor. For more than seventy years, Elliott Erwitt has left an indelible mark on international visual culture. It is no wonder that he is considered by critics to be one of the most influential photographers of our time.
